Disadvantages of Farm Simulator 26 Farming Life
The software occasionally suffers from repetitive task loops during mid-game, where waiting for crops to grow can feel slow without enough premium currency to speed things up. Some players note that the early tutorial, while helpful, lingers a bit too long on basic actions before unlocking advanced features. The camera controls on certain devices require a steady hand, as accidental taps can shift the view unexpectedly. Storage management becomes a minor hassle once you own multiple vehicles and animal pens, as the inventory screen lacks a bulk-sort option. A few users report occasional frame drops when rendering large fields with many active animals, especially on older Android models. These issues do not break the experience but are worth knowing before diving in.

Guide and Usage Tips
Start by focusing on a single crop type, such as wheat or corn, to build a stable income before expanding to animals or orchards. Use the in-game calendar to plan planting cycles around market demand; some crops sell for more during specific seasons. Keep an eye on your equipment durability bar and repair tools before they break to avoid costly downtime. For smoother performance, close background apps and lower the graphics quality in the settings menu if your device gets warm during long sessions. The storage shed can be upgraded early to prevent overflow of harvested goods. Enable push notifications for harvest reminders so you never miss the optimal collection window. Finally, experiment with decorative layouts; a well-organized farm reduces travel time between tasks.
